Maconaquah has enjoyed the comforts of home their last three games, but now they'll head out on the road. They will challenge the West Lafayette Red Devils at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Both come into the match b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
On Saturday, Maconaquah s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 2-1 win over Culver Academies.
The match was a true back-and-forth as no team won consecutive sets, but in the end it was Maconaquah who won the one that mattered.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-17, 19-25, 15-10.
Meanwhile, West Lafayette waltzed into their game on Saturday with six straight wins... but they left with seven. They came out on top against the Tigers by a score of 2-0.
The 2-0 score doesn't show just how dominant West Lafayette was: they took both sets by at least 11 points. The match finished with set scores of 25-14, 25-8.
Maconaquah's record is now 18-11. As for West Lafayette, they are on a roll lately: they've won 13 of their last 14 mat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 22-5 record this season.
Maconaquah came up short against West Lafayette when the teams last played on Saturday, falling 2-0. Can Maconaquah av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
